Description

Neodymium Bromide is an inorganic salt of the rare earth metal neodymium, widely recognized for its role as a versatile precursor in advanced materials synthesis. Its high reactivity and specific ionic characteristics make it a valuable component for creating specialized compounds with tailored optical, magnetic, and catalytic properties. This material is essential for researchers and manufacturers in the fields of specialty chemicals, catalysis, and materials science who require high-purity rare earth reagents.

Application

  • Catalyst Precursor: Serves as a starting material in the synthesis of Ziegler-Natta and other organometallic catalysts for polymerization reactions.
  • Optical Material Synthesis: Used in the preparation of neodymium-doped glasses, crystals, and phosphors for laser and optical amplifier applications.
  • Chemical Vapor Deposition (CVD): Acts as a volatile source for depositing neodymium-containing thin films in semiconductor and coating processes.
  • Research & Development: A key reagent in academic and industrial R&D for exploring new rare earth chemistry, magnetic materials, and luminescent complexes.
  • Specialty Chemical Manufacturing: Employed as an intermediate in the production of other neodymium salts and organoneodymium compounds.

Basic Information

Product Name Neodymium Bromide
CAS No. 13536-80-6
Molecular Formula NdBr3 (often hydrated as NdBr3·xH2O)
Molecular Weight 384.00 g/mol (anhydrous)
Synonyms Neodymium(III) bromide; Tribromoneodymium; Neodymium tribromide; Neodymium bromide (NdBr3); UNII-8V71L2A7VH

Storage

Preserve in a tightly closed container, protected from light. Due to its hygroscopic nature, this material must be stored in a cool, dry place under an inert atmosphere or in a desiccator to prevent moisture absorption. Recommended storage temperature is 15-25°C.
